SAN ANTONIO – Three people are in the hospital with serious injuries following a three-car crash Saturday.
Police said a maroon Chevy Tahoe was driving the wrong way on Babcock Road when the driver crashed head-on into a Buick. A black BMW then crashed into them.
There was one person in each vehicle. All three were taken to University Hospital with life-threatening injuries.
Police said the driver of the Tahoe didn’t appear to be intoxicated but will undergo a blood draw test.
